Upaniṣads · Mahā 5.41
Devanāgarī

मृगतृष्णाम्बुबुद्ध्य्यादिशान्तिमात्रात्मकस्त्वसौ ये तु मोहार्णवात्तीर्णास्तैः प्राप्तं परमं पदम्

Transliteración (IAST)

mṛgatṛṣṇāmbubuddhyyādiśāntimātrātmakastvasau ye tu mohārṇavāttīrṇāstaiḥ prāptaṃ paramaṃ padam

Palabra por palabra
SánscritoIASTSignificado
मृग-तृष्णा-अम्बु-बुद्धि-आदिmṛga-tṛṣṇā-ambu-buddhi-ādithe thought of water in the mirage and the like; the notion of moisture in the haze and suchlike
शान्ति-मात्र-आत्मकः तु असौśānti-mātra-ātmakaḥ tu asauit consists in the mere quieting of that; it lies solely in the stilling of that
ये तु मोह-अर्णवात् तीर्णाःye tu moha-arṇavāt tīrṇāḥbut they who have crossed the ocean of delusion; those, though, who have traversed the sea of blinding
तैः प्राप्तम् परमम् पदम्taiḥ prāptam paramam padamby them the supreme state is attained; by them the highest station is obtained
Traducción

“It consists merely in the quieting of the thought of water in the mirage and the like; and they who have crossed the ocean of delusion have attained the supreme state.”
